Output 2e6a577a03c81046b8511741eec013538593e669b83d47e3e5fad40f9ef7d4a8:0

value
22475310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9059866f039d14586e260388ec4e3eee99f150a2 OP_EQUAL
address
MM4QnNMQJvpKQzAfEbvDohA1f23qtwuXTE
transaction
2e6a577a03c81046b8511741eec013538593e669b83d47e3e5fad40f9ef7d4a8
spent
true